CentOS中的DHCP和静态IP在多个方面存在显著区别:
DHCP(动态主机配置协议)
- 自动分配IP地址:
- DHCP服务器会自动为客户端设备分配一个可用的IP地址。
- 这个过程是动态的,每次客户端重新连接网络时可能会获得不同的IP地址。
- 简化网络管理:
- 管理员无需手动为每台设备配置IP地址,减少了出错的可能性。
- 适用于大规模网络环境,可以快速部署新设备。
- IP地址池管理:
- DHCP服务器维护一个IP地址池,从中分配地址给请求的设备。
- 可以设置租约时间,控制IP地址的使用时长。
- 依赖性:
- 客户端设备必须支持并启用DHCP客户端功能才能获取IP地址。
- 如果DHCP服务器不可用,客户端可能无法连接到网络。
- 安全性考虑:
- 由于IP地址是动态分配的,攻击者更难追踪特定设备的活动。
- 但这也意味着需要额外的措施来确保只有授权设备能够获取IP地址。
- 适用场景:
- 办公室、学校、家庭网络等需要频繁变动设备连接的环境。
静态IP(固定IP地址)
- 手动配置IP地址:
- 网络管理员需要为每台设备手动设置一个固定的IP地址。
- 这个过程相对繁琐,但提供了更高的控制力。
- 稳定性强:
- 设备的IP地址始终保持不变,便于远程访问和管理。
- 适用于服务器、网络打印机等需要稳定网络连接的设备。
- 易于故障排查:
- 由于IP地址固定,可以更容易地定位和解决网络问题。
- 安全性较高:
- 可以通过配置防火墙规则来限制特定IP地址的访问权限。
- 减少了因IP地址变动而导致的潜在安全风险。
- 资源占用:
- 静态IP地址需要占用网络中的IP地址资源,不适合大规模部署。
- 在IP地址资源紧张的环境中可能不适用。
- 适用场景:
- 服务器、网络设备、远程监控系统等需要长期稳定运行的场合。
总结
- DHCP适合快速部署、管理大量设备且对IP地址灵活性要求较高的环境。
- 静态IP则更适合需要稳定连接、便于管理和具备特定安全需求的场景。
在实际应用中,也可以结合使用这两种方式,例如为关键服务器分配静态IP,而为普通办公设备使用DHCP。